Celebrating John Glenn and the 50th Anniversary of His Historic Journey Into Space

On Feb. 20, around 600 people attended a scholarship gala at the Ohio Union celebrating the legacy of John Glenn on the 50th anniversary of his Friendship 7 space flight. The keynote speaker was NASA astronaut Mark Kelly, commander of the space shuttle Endeavour’s final mission. Tickets were $1,000, with the more than $2 million in proceeds benefiting faculty, students and programs related to science and technology research and policy at the John Glenn School of Public Policy and the College of Engineering.
